santa cruz short sale: Santa Cruz County Short Sale: Represented Soquel Seller - 10/29/08 07:11 AM
I just recently closed another short sale in Soquel, which is located in Santa Cruz County.  In this transaction I represented the seller.  In this case the seller had purchased the property (though a different Realtor) at the peak of the market in 2005 for $729,000 with a first loan and a second loan through Chase.   We just closed at $540,000 which is about a 25% loss for the bank.  The two biggest challenges in selling this home was getting the bank to be realistic on price, and finding a buyer that was willing to be patient enough to wait for … (0 comments)
